C++標準化委員会の細分化された研究グループにSG12 UB(Undefined Behavior)というのがあって、何やってるんだろうー?と思ってました。(とくにチェックしてませんでした)
たまたま見つけたこの記事に、その活動の一端がありました。
Integer Undefined Behaviors in Open Source Crypto Libraries
オープンソースの暗号化ライブラリを調査して、整数の未定義動作に依存したコードを見つけ、それを開発者に報告しまくってました。
すごい偉いなー、と思いました!
宣伝: 『プログラミングの魔導書 Vol.3』 予約受付中です。 http://longgate.co.jp/books/grimoire-vol3.html |